> So the BAI cmavo are almost never used?

I didn't say that. Some BAIs are indeed very frequent (e.g. tai, ki'u,
ja'e, (se)pi'o, ...)

But there are lots and lots of BAI cmavo, and many of them are hardly
ever used.
